California is working on solutions to worsening climate change. Will they be enough?
In the opening chapter of "The Ministry for the Future," science-fiction author Kim Stanley Robinson details a calamitous heat wave that kills almost all the residents of a small town. In another chapter, he imagines a catastrophic flood that wipes out Los Angeles. The late Octavia Butler described a Southern California reeling from years of drought in "Parable of the Sower," and Paolo Bacigalupi writes about a near-future Southwest that's also been devastated by drought. Sci-fi writers have long conceived worlds in which extreme weather events upend the lives of its inhabitants, but with every passing, warming year, their scenarios feel more prophetic. Last September, record-shattering temperatures nearly broke the state's power grid, and according to a Times investigation, extreme heat waves are killing more Californians than official records show.
